Embodiment Construction

[0026] Such as figure 1 As shown, the insert 1 shown in this figure has a roughly W-shaped profile, with two pairs of fixing means 3 and perforating means 2, two on the sides and one in the middle, each of which is harpoon-shaped and has cutting edge. The shape of the insert 1 can have two symmetrical sides and a middle part, which can be located on one longitudinal arm of the syringe shaft. In said figure, the side perforated harpoons can be seen adjacent to the corresponding front fixed harpoons.

[0027] figure 2 The syringe 4 is shown in its initial position before use. Said syringe 4 has a cylindrical wall element 5 terminating at one end in a mouth 6 and at the other end in a circular opening surrounded by a lower ring 7 . The inner element 8 has a plunger 10 at one end and a push base 11 at the other, connected by an intermediate rod 9 formed by a vertical wall 12 with an X-shaped section. Said rod 9 also comprises at least one inner ring 13 .

Abstract

Safety insert for disposable syringes, comprising at least one attachment member whose point allows advance of the stem during injection of the syringe content and prevents its retraction once said injection is performed on attaching to the inner walls of the cylinder, and having at least one perforating member with a gaff at its end able to dig into the plunger and pass through its wall, thus breaking the tightness of the compartment of the cylinder intended to contain the substance to be injected when retraction of the stem is attempted following the injection.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a safety insert for a disposable syringe, which can be guided into the interior of the syringe. Background technique [0002] Presently, the use of disposable syringes is of great importance for avoiding the transmission of infectious diseases such as hepatitis or AIDS, both for healthy persons and for actual users of such syringes. [0003] These syringes are very simple in construction, as they generally consist of a cylindrical element, usually made of plastic material, with a needle tip at one end and a circular opening at the other, and an inner element with a The sealing plunger and the other end is the base to push or pull the plunger, and the stem connecting the two end elements. [0004] Despite the fact that these disposable syringes, usually made of plastic, are inexpensive and suitable for only one use, they are also frequently reused, especially by drug users who inject substances intravenously, who are at greater...
